Human Contact Network is a kind of DTN (Delay Tolerant Networks), and is closely related with people' activities. Owing to its intermittent connectivity and unique human mobility patterns, how to transmit data in an effective way is a challenging problem for DTN. In this paper, considering the regularity of people activities, we propose a THM (Trip History Model) to record the activities of people. Through the spatial and temporal characteristic of people stored in THM, the further moving destination can be predicted. In order to transfer data more reasonable, Fuzzy inference Routing algorithm has been proposed, which introduce fuzzy inference into routing scheme to help select a better sensor node. Our simulation results show that, compared with LABEL and PROPHET algorithms, FIRA effectively improves the routing performance of the network.
